To flatten a surface: In an open part, click Flatten (Surfaces toolbar) or Insert > Surface > Flatten. The Flatten PropertyManager displays. Select faces in the graphics area or from the FeatureManager design tree. Then select a vertex. A preview of the flatten surface appears.

WebYou are in "Flat Pattern" mode for sheet metal. Creating sheet metal features is not appropriate in that mode so they are grayed out. Clicking the button in the top right of the viewport will bring you back out of this to the folded state of the model. My understanding is that this feature is "greyed out" in … d form chemistryWebNov 22, 2016 · The trim surface command is used to trim surface features. Your model consists of a solid (extrude-thin1) and a curve (which you don't really need). You don't have any surface features in your model which is why the command is greyed out. Delete the curve feature, but keep its sketch.
